Regional Map
Explanation of the parts of Sermo;
The North (Includes Ocasus, Blammocratz, and all nations north) - Home to Ocasus and Summland, the Northern part of Sermo is the home and meeting place of regional politics. The countries in the north (with the exception of Blammocratz) are usually filled with densely populated cities, beautiful forests and wildlife, and the home of the technology industry. The landscape of the north is generally mountainous.
The Midlands - (Includes Hippostania, Feriron, Lena-Rutland, Nikomania, Terra of Decor, and all nations north until Bonnabal.) - Home to Valkry, Lena-Rutland, the Heartlands, and many more, the midlands is known for the production of goods for export out of Sermo. Many of the goods include Automobiles and Food. The countries in the midlands usually have only a small part of the city densely populated, and then surrounded by suburban areas. The countryside of the Midlands is home to many plains, farms, and flatlands. The midlands also contains the majority of the Sermo population.
The South - (Includes Kyzl, Cyprocor, Deltaniana, TGC, and Borderworlds, and all nations south.) Home to Kyzl, Soalma, Greater Sermo, and many others, the South is known for mining and processing of many valuable resources available in the area. Many of the goods include Uranium, Gold, Silver, and Oil. The countries in the South are usually not very densely populated, but larger physically in comparison to the Midlands. The countryside in the Midlands is home to many Oil Derricks, Wind Farms, Flatlands, and quarries.
